Description
The issue is related to a password vulnerability in the Medtronic Pelvic Health clinician apps installed on the Smart Programmer mobile device. This vulnerability could potentially result in unauthorized control of the clinician therapy application, which has greater control over therapy parameters than the patient app. However, changes still cannot be made outside of the established therapy parameters of the programmer. For unauthorized access to occur, an individual would need physical access to the Smart Programmer.
Recommendations
At the moment, there is no information about a newer version that contains a fix for this vulnerability.
